1915901Portland 1915. Very good. Sixteen cyanotypes approximately 5 x 7 inches. Minor wear and toning at edges images generally sharp with nice contrast. Sixteen cyanotypes depicting the activities of the lumber industry in Oregon taken by an unidentified photographer. The images include scenes of the premises of the Oregon Planing Mill in Portland Globe Mills and a more rural lumber yard and timber camp in the Pacific Northwest. The Oregon Planing Mill was located at 224 2nd Street in Portland and was active in the 1910s and 1920s leading us to a date for the group of images. Two photographs are of the planing mill one showing the outside and the other the interior. Another set of images shows the exterior and interior works of the Globe Mill. Two images show tidy rows of houses which may be a logging camp or an early rural development. The remaining ten images are industrial in nature depicting large buildings and lumber yards full of cut timber planks. All the images have good contrast and are quite sharp with an eye for composition and detail. An interesting group of particularly fine cyanotypes. unknown books
1872WRCAM29311Various places 1872. Twelve cards each 17 x 13 inches a.e.g. with manuscript captions in lower margins. Images are 9 x 6 1/2 inches except the two oval images of San Francisco. Some minor soiling on cards some images slightly faded. Very good. Archivally matted protected with a mylar sheet. An excellent collection of views quite early for Hawaii and New Zealand. The four views of Honolulu include one wide view of the town a view of a side street with a church steeple in the background the Pali mountain pass and the harbor with several large vessels at anchor. In New Zealand the Supreme Court building in Christchurch and the city of Littleton are displayed. The San Francisco images include the Palace Hotel and the famous Cliff House. Of particular interest are the three views of the Central Pacific Railway. The sections of the track include Capestown the Palisade and Summit Station each with fresh evidence of the line's recent completion. Also in the collection is one image of a railroad along the banks of Salt Lake and three wide views of Salt Lake City one with the Mormon tabernacle completed in 1871 prominently featured. An attractive collection of views each quite displayable. unknown books

1887WRCAM55700Chicago: Chicago Legal News Company 1887. 27pp. Original printed gray-green wrappers. Minor chipping to wrappers light soiling and toning small circular library stamp for the Lowell Historical Society on front wrapper and titlepage. Text a bit toned but otherwise clean. Very good. A rare promotional pamphlet touting the services of Stanley's Western Detective Agency in Chicago. The company was formed in the year of this pamphlet's publication by Charles E. Stanley a well-respected thirteen- year veteran of Pinkerton's. The text contains information on the services the agency could provide; brief vignettes of several famous cases involving Stanley himself including murder confidence scams western train robbery and a child abduction case among others; and a list of legal and law enforcement personnel associated with the agency in Chicago Ohio Pennsylvania West Virginia Connecticut Indiana Michigan Minnesota Wisconsin Kansas Iowa and Colorado. The front wrapper reads "CALL IN A DETECTIVE" and the rear wrapper bears an ad for Stanley's Detective Agency with contact information. Rare with no copies in auction records and only one copy recorded in OCLC at the University of Regina in Saskatchewan. OCLC 56278798. Chicago Legal News Company unknown books

Charts housed within. 10-1/2" x 9-3/8" <br/><br/>"The Rio Grande was the epitome of mountain railroading with a motto of Through the Rockies not around them and later Main line through the Rockies both referring to the Rocky Mountains. The D&RGW operated the highest mainline rail line in the United States over the 10240 feet 3120 m Tennessee Pass in Colorado and the famed routes through the Moffat Tunnel and the Royal Gorge. At its height around 1890 the D&RG had the largest operating narrow gauge railroad network in North America. Known for its independence the D&RGW operated the last private intercity passenger train in the United States the Rio Grande Zephyr." Wikipedia.
